Utility of 4-(4-Bromophenyl)-4-oxo-but-2-enoic acid in synthesis of some important heterocyclic compounds

Rizk, Sameh Ahmed; El-Hashash, M. A.; Shaker, Sohir A.; Mostafa, K. K.;

Abstract


THE PRESENT work deals with the generation and synthesis of different heterocycles via the treatment of 3-(4-bromobenzoyl) prop-2-enoic acid (1) with thiourea, ethylcyanoacetate malononitrile & acetylacetone in presence of amm.acetate and / or piperidine , 2-amino-5-phthalimidomethy l1,3,4-thiadiazole, methyl thioglycolate 4-bromoaniline and ethylacetoacetate to afford Michael and aza-Michael adduct that cyclized by hydroxyl amine and hydrazine hydrate, respectively. Additionally, utility of 2-(2-amino-5-phthalimidomethyl 1,3,4-thiadiazol-2-yl)-4-(4-bromophenyl)-4-oxo-butanoic acid (4) as a key starting material to synthesize some important heterocycles include fused oxoimidazolo [2,3-b]-1,3,4-thiadiazole.
